Celtic Reportedly value Matt at €40 million, and quite rightly too. It was reported at the weekend that Atletico Madrid will be looking to test Celtic’s resolve with yet another bid for Matt O’Riley.

Article image:Celtic increase valuation of Matt O’Riley to €40 million ahead of bidding frenzy

Well now the Spanish giants know the asking price and will be well aware of the strong interest in signing the Celtic Player of the Year this summer. According to one of Spain’s leading newspapers Diario AS, the La Liga side will look to snap up the Danish international if they negotiate the contract termination of current midfielder Saul.

According to the reliable outlet, Celtic now value Matt at a whopping €40 million (£33.8 million) a significant increase on the £18 million the Spanish club believed Matt was worth just a short few months ago when they attempted to acquire him on loan with an obligation to buy, this summer.

If Celtic are going to be giving multiple top league clubs the entirely reasonable €40 million valuation then it’s likely that the Scottish transfer record, held of course by Celtic, will be smashed this summer.

Celtic is expecting plenty of interest in Matt O’Riley this summer and this time there will be no bargains. If the asking price is met that will also see Matt’s previous club MK Dons benefit from their reported 10% sell-on clause, so after selling the player to Celtic for the release clause value of £1.5m in January 2022, they could be set to pick up double that after O’Riley’s development at Celtic.
